Machinery manufacturers are going big in Asia as recent data shows that five out of nine companies that topped the list of being the largest in the industry are from the said region. Although construction leaders from the U.S. got the first and last spot based on construction equipment sales as published by Statistica, it is still undeniable that machinery manufacturers in the East are becoming more powerful and influential in the market.
Let’s take a look at who these machinery manufacturers are and their construction equipment sales in U.S. billion dollars.
Caterpillar – US $26.64 billion
One of the world’s leading manufacturer of construction and mining equipment, diesel and natural gas engines, industrial gas turbines and diesel-electric locomotives. The company principally operates through its three primary segments – Construction Industries, Resource Industries and Energy & Transportation – and also provides financing and related services through its Financial Products segment.
Komatsu – US $19.24 billion
Komatsu is a Japanese company which main businesses are manufacturing and sales of construction and mining equipment, utilities, forest machines and industrial machinery. Komatsu Group is consists of Komatsu Ltd., and 266 other companies which have 193 operations. The company has more than 60,00 employees.
